Cultural Heritage at Albacete's Regional Museum

Step into the past with Albacete's Regional Museum, home to vital archaeological insights.

Founded in 1974, the museum was established to preserve and display the region’s historical artifacts. Key features include well-documented archaeological exhibits such as a collection of Roman ivory and amber articulated dolls, reflecting the cultural and historical significance of Albacete. The museum's modern architecture enhances the visitor experience, providing an inviting space for exploration.

Must-See Wonders

  • 🪡 Articulated Dolls: Marvel at intricate Roman craftsmanship in articulated dolls made of ivory and amber.
  • 🏺 Archaeological Finds: Explore well-documented archaeological exhibits showcasing the rich heritage of the region.
  • 🖼️ Unique Architecture: Appreciate the museum's contemporary design, which complements its historical exhibits.

The museum is free to enter, making it accessible for tourists, families, and historians alike.
